Second Stage Round 9: Basketbol Brno - B&W Opava 90-86 OT
Date: April 9, 2011
Leading B&W Opava (17-12) recorded its twelfth loss on the court of fourth ranked Basketbol Brno on Saturday night. Visitors were defeated by Basketbol Brno in overtime 90-86. It ended at the same time the seven-game winning streak of B&W Opava. The hosts trailed by 5 points after three quarters before their 18-17 charge, which allowed them to tie the game at the end of regular time and get a 8-point victory in overtime. Basketbol Brno outrebounded B&W Opava 46-33 including 30 on the offensive glass. The best player for the winners was Slovakian center Peter Sedmak (203-85) who had a double-double by scoring 26 points and 11 rebounds. American center Stephen Castleberry (214-81, college: Rider, agency: Court Side) chipped in 15 points and 9 rebounds (on 7-of-8 shooting from the field). At the other side the best for losing team was forward Jakub Blazek (203-80) who recorded 34 points (!!!) and 4 steals (on 13-of-16 shooting from the field) and forward Jan Kratochvil (200-82) added 15 points and 9 rebounds respectively.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. B&W Opava's coach David Klapetek rotated ten players in this game, but that didn't help. The victory was the third consecutive win for Basketbol Brno. They moved-up to third place in A2, which they share with USK Praha. Loser B&W Opava still keeps top position with 12 games lost. Basketbol Brno will meet at home USK Praha (#4) in the next round. B&W Opava will play against Basketbal Svitavy and hope to secure a win.
